  • Contributing Institution: Museum of Ventura County
    Title: Andy Anderson collection on oil production
    Creator: Andy, Anderson
    Identifier/Call Number: MVC023
    Identifier/Call Number: 134
    Physical Description: 2 Cubic Feet (1 box, 13 ledgers)
    Date (inclusive): 1919-1978
    Abstract: Andy Anderson is senior vice-president of operations at energy company Aera. Headquartered in Bakersfield, Aera is a major oil and gas producer. Anderson has worked in the energy sector for over 35 years. He has a chemical engineering degree from Stanford University. This collection contains material on oil production as gathered by Andy Anderson. Materials include books, bulletins, graphs, maps, other publications (pamphlets, booklets, and catalogs), correspondence, and logbooks and ledgers used when drilling wells. Included is a set of American Petroleum Institute papers No. 801-32A through 32M with comments.
